- the invention relates to a device for connecting two neighboring Car body of rail-bound vehicles, especially a terminal one Car body with a middle car body one of three car bodies, namely two terminal car bodies and the one arranged between them middle car body existing train, esp. a tram train, whereby the middle car body via a joint with the neighboring, esp. terminal car body is connected and the adjacent car body one, common, in particular biaxial bogie are supported.
- the car bodies in such facilities are of low-floor design, So far was the low-floor space of the middle car body, due to the curve geometry (envelope curve) limits, like the space in the middle Car body was limited, even if it wasn't low-floor Constructions.
- the striving for this, given the envelope is the to enlarge (lengthen) the middle body, which means that Low-floor constructions also the low-floor section in the middle car body could be extended.
- the hinge axis of the middle car body is arranged on a crossbar, which is immovable, but preferably pivotable about a horizontal axis the car body adjacent to the middle car body is connected.
- the cross clip arranged between two fists having the pivot bearing of the transverse clasp is, which are fixed to a support plate, which is below the floor level of the terminal car body is arranged, possibly on one, a Extension of the terminal car body forming, with this fixed connected adapter.
- This construction ensures that the floor level is maintained the installation of the swivel bearing is not changed.
- the support plate the Fists part of an adapter it is possible to use existing (terminal) Converting the car body is particularly easy, if necessary without welding work, because the adapter is only to be installed on the existing body, e.g. by means of screw connection.
- a further embodiment of the device according to the invention is thereby characterized in that the two having the pivot bearing of the transverse clasp Fists, preferably at a distance from the swivel bearing of the cross clip, each with one are provided parallel to the pivot axis of the transverse clasp, in each one on the body adjacent to the middle body fixed arm engages.
- This configuration allows a further improvement in Adaptability of the pivot bearing to the alignment, in particular crests and Tubs
- connection of the swivel bearing construction with the neighboring one Car body can be done in a structurally simple manner in that according to a Special embodiment of the device according to the invention on the support plate to the side of the fists that have the swivel bearings of the cross clip, esp. cranked cantilever arms of the body adjacent to the middle body, e.g. are fixed by means of screws.
- the support plate which is below and at a distance from the ground level of the middle car body adjacent car body is arranged on a Ball slewing ring of the bogie, which is preferably designed as a Jacobs frame, rests, the ball slewing ring preferably on one of the side cheeks of the bogie connecting cradle is attached.
- the support plate also the support function of the adapter and the associated Car body on the bogie. It is particularly useful if Jacobs undercarriages are available since these already have two to each other concentric ball slewing rings which are fitted on a the opposite cradle connecting cradle are mounted. Such Jacobs bogies allow a kinematically perfect passage through the Track arches.
- one of the Ball slewing rings preferably the larger, omitted.
- the middle car body formed at least over part of its length as a low-floor car body.
- the possibility of extending the middle car body compared to a construction in the swivel bearing of the middle car body and pivot bearing of the bogie coincide or coaxial to each other, as particularly advantageous.

- A, B and C are three connected to each other Inscribed car body.
- the car body C forms the middle Car body and car bodies A and B are terminal.
- the middle one Car body C has a joint, the axis of which is designated 10, with the adjacent car bodies A and B articulated.
- the neighboring ones Car bodies B and C or C and A are each on a bogie 17 and 18 respectively (Fig. 3 to 6) supported. It is in the illustrated embodiment around biaxial bogies.
- the axis 10 coincides with the axis of rotation 20 or 21 of the bogie.
- a value of 52.05 ° is set as the angle between the terminal car bodies B, A and the middle car body C.
- a low-floor space with a length L C1 of 3160 mm can be achieved in the middle car body C.
- the constructive means for extending the three car bodies B, C and A can be seen in more detail in FIGS. 3-9.
- the hinge axis 10 of the middle car body C is arranged on a crossbar 9. This crossbar is immovably connected to the car body B or A adjacent to the middle car body C.
- the transverse clasp 9 is preferably arranged to be pivotable about a horizontal axis 21.
- the pivot bearings 22 of the cross clip 9 are arranged in fists 8, between which the cross clip 9 is pivotable.
- the fists 8 are fixed to a support plate 1, which is arranged below the floor level 14 of the terminal car body A or B. It is expedient to arrange the support plate on an adapter 7 which forms an extension of the terminal car body A or B and is firmly connected to the latter.
- the length of the adapter is designated L v in FIG. 2 and is 1000 mm.
- the adapter 7 can be connected to the respective terminal car body A or B by screwing.
- the two fists 8 having the pivot bearings 22 of the transverse clip 9 can each be provided with a pin 2 running parallel to the pivot axis 21 of the transverse clip 9.
- the support plate 1 rests on a ball slewing ring 4 as a Jacobs frame trained bogie 17, 18, with the ball slewing ring 4 on the Sidewalls of the bogie connecting cradle 5 is attached.
- the one in one Jacobs bogie also has an outer ball slewing ring Embodiment omitted.
- 13 is a roll support drawn, by means of which the middle car body C roof side with the adapter 7 is connected.

- Einrichtung zum Verbinden von zwei benachbarten Wagenkasten (B,C; A,C,) schienengebundener Fahrzeuge, insbesondere eines endständigen Wagenkastens (A bzw. B) mit einem mittleren Wagenkasten (C) eines aus drei Wagenkasten (A,B, C), nämlich zwei endständigen Wagenkasten (A,B) und dem zwischen ihnen angeordneten mittleren Wagenkasten (C) bestehenden Zuges, insbes. eines Straßenbahnzuges, wobei der mittlere Wagenkasten (C) über ein Gelenk mit dem benachbarten, insbes. endständigen Wagenkasten (B bzw. A) verbunden ist und die benachbarten Wagenkasten (B, C; A, C) an einem, ihnen gemeinsamen, insbesondere zweiachsigen Drehgestell (17; 18) abgestützt sind, dadurch gekennzeichnet, daß die Achse (10) des Gelenks des mittleren Wagenkastens (C) in Richtung der Längsachse (19) des benachbarten Wagenkastens (B bzw. A) gegenüber der Drehachse (20, 21) des Drehgestells (17; 18) in Richtung gegen den mittleren Wagenkasten (C) versetzt angeordnet ist.
- Einrichtung nach Anspruch 1, dadurch gekennzeichnet, daß die Gelenksachse (10) des mittleren Wagenkastens (C) auf einer Querspange (9) angeordnet ist, die unverschieblich, bevorzugt jedoch um eine horizontale Achse (21) schwenkbar mit dem, dem mittleren Wagenkasten (C) benachbarten Wagenkasten (B bzw. A) verbunden ist.
- Einrichtung nach Anspruch 2, dadurch gekennzeichnet, daß die Querspange (9) zwischen zwei, die Schwenklager (22) der Querspange (9) aufweisenden Fäusten (8) angeordnet ist, die an einer Tragplatte (1) fixiert sind, die unterhalb des Bodenniveaus (14) des endständigen Wagenkastens (A bzw. B) angeordnet ist, gegebenenfalls an einem, eine Verlängerung des endständigen Wagenkastens (A bzw. B) bildenden, mit diesem fest verbundenen Adapter (7).
- Einrichtung nach Anspruch 3, dadurch gekennzeichnet, daß die die Schwenklager (22) der Querspange (9) aufweisenden beiden Fäuste (8), bevorzugt im Abstand vom Schwenklager (22) der Querspange (9), je mit einem parallel zur Schwenkachse (21) der Querspange (9) verlaufenden Zapfen (2) versehen sind, in deren jeden ein an dem dem mittleren Wagenkasten (C) benachbarten Wagenkasten (B) fixierter Arm (23) eingreift.
- Einrichtung nach Anspruch 3, dadurch gekennzeichnet, daß an der Tragplatte (1) seitlich von den die Schwenklager (22) der Querspange (9) aufweisenden Fäusten (8), insbes. abgekröpfte Kragarme (24) des dem mittleren Wagenkasten (C) benachbarten Wagenkastens (A), z.B. mittels Schrauben, fixiert sind.
- Einrichtung nach einem der Ansprüche 3 bis 5, dadurch gekennzeichnet, daß die Tragplatte (1), die unter dem und im Abstand vom Bodenniveau (14) des dem mittleren Wagenkasten (C) benachbarten Wagenkastens (A bzw. B) angeordnet ist, an einem Kugeldrehkranz (4) des, bevorzugt als Jacobs-Gestell ausgebildeten Drehgestells (17; 18) aufliegt, wobei der Kugeldrehkranz (4) bevorzugt auf einer die Seitenwangen (25, 26) des Drehgestells (17; 18) verbindenden Wiege (5) befestigt ist.
- Einrichtung nach einem der Ansprüche 1 bis 6, dadurch gekennzeichnet, daß zumindest der mittlere Wagenkasten (C) auf einem Teil seiner Länge als Niederflurwagenkasten ausgebildet ist.
- Einrichtung nach einem der Ansprüche 1 bis 7, dadurch gekennzeichnet, daß der mittlere Wagenkasten (C) dachseitig über eine Wankabstützung (13) mit dem Adapter (7) verbunden ist.
